← Sözlük
Sözlük · Geliştirme

Rust nedir?

Hafıza güvenliğini ön planda tutan, yüksek performanslı bir sistem programlama dilidir.

Tanım

Rust, özellikle bilgisayarın kaynaklarını (bellek gibi) çok verimli kullanan ve hata yapmayı zorlaştıran modern bir dildir. Yazılımda sıkça karşılaşılan çökme ve güvenlik açıklarını daha kod yazılırken engellemeye çalışır. Hem hızlıdır hem de güvenlidir.

Hızlı bir yarış arabası tasarlarken, sürücünün hata yapmasını engelleyen gelişmiş güvenlik sistemlerine sahip bir araç üretmek gibidir.

Nasıl çalışır?

Yazılımcılar kodlarını Rust diliyle yazar ve derleyici (compiler) aracılığıyla bilgisayarın çalıştırabileceği hale getirir. Derleyici, kodunuzda mantıksal bir hata varsa sizi çalıştırmadan önce uyarır.

Nerede kullanılır?

İşletim sistemlerinde, tarayıcılarda ve yüksek performans gerektiren yapay zeka altyapılarında kullanılır.

Sık karıştırılanlar

C veya C++ ile karıştırılır; Rust aynı performansı daha güvenli bir şekilde sunmayı hedefler.

Sıkça sorulanlar

Neden bu kadar popüler?

Hem çok hızlı olması hem de yazılım hatalarını ciddi oranda azaltması nedeniyle.

İlgili terimler

İlgili araçlar

Bu açıklama TreScout için sade dille hazırlandı · yanlış ya da eksik gördüğünüz bir şey olursa hello@trescout.com. TreScout her gün GitHub, Hacker News ve HuggingFace trendlerini Türkçe özetler.